firmware upgrade, this can be done yourself at home using the official website and their program called SEUS, or you can take it to a service centre if there is any near you, I would recommend letting someone who knows what they are doing do the first one for you. But you have no need to update yet though, as your phone will most likely have the newest level of firmware on it anyway
